How to sync Photoshop actions between 2 computers

I recently purchased a new desktop computer and installed the creative cloud app. I'm trying to figure out how I can sync the setting from my laptop photoshop app with the new desktop photoshop. Since both are applications are part of my creative cloud subscription I thought it would be easy to simple sync all settings from my laptop to the cloud and then they would show up on my desktop. What I would like to have show up in PS on the new computer is all of the actions I created on my other computer's PS. Thanks in advance!

Correct answer Trevor.Dennis

You can certainly select an Actions Group and save it so you can load it on another computer.  Note that it has to be a group/folder and not individual actions.

Unfortunately we can't now sync Preferences between different computers, mores the pity. Things like work spaces and custom toolbars, keyboards shortcuts, are stored outside of Preferences.  There is no easy and direct way to save those, but you could try sharing the file.  I've never tried this myself.

C:\Users\Your User Name\AppData\Roaming\Adobe\Adobe Photoshop CC 2018\Adobe Photoshop CC 2018 Settings\

This shows you other file locations, and will be valid for all CC versions
